Position: Certified Strength & Conditioning Specialist

Location: On-Site at D1 Training Alliance – Alliance Town Center, Fort Worth, TX

YOU MUST HAVE A VALID STRENGTH AND CONDITIONING CERTIFICATION TO BE CONSIDERED

What You'll Be Doing

As a D1 Coach, you’re more than a trainer—you’re a leader, a motivator, and the person who sets the tone in every session. You'll guide athletes through structured group workouts and personal training sessions that build strength, speed, confidence, and resilience.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ead high-energy group training sessions for youth and adults
  • Coach with authority: control the room, keep energy high, and maintain flow
  • Adapt exercises to individual ability levels while keeping workouts on track
  • Monitor athlete progress and provide honest, motivational feedback
  • Educate athletes on movement mechanics, recovery, and injury prevention
  • Foster connection with each athlete to boost retention and results
  • Maintain a safe, professional, and uplifting training environment
  • Drive growth by bringing in personal clients and supporting team training contracts

What We're Looking For

  • Experience: 2 years coaching in a strength & conditioning, team training, or personal training setting
  • Certifications:
    • Valid CPR/AED/First Aid certification
    • NCCA-accredited certification (NASM, NSCA, ACSM, ACE, etc.)
    • CSCS is preferred
  • Athletic Background: Played competitive sports? Huge plus. You’ll connect better and coach smarter.
  • Education: High school diploma required; degree in Exercise Science or related field preferred
  • Personality Fit: Confident, coachable, energetic, strong communicator, thrives in team settings

Compensation

This is an hourly, non-exempt position with tiered pay based on session type:

  • Group Training Sessions: Competitive hourly rate
  • Personal Training Sessions: Higher hourly rate for 1-on-1 coaching
  • Team Training Programs: Pay varies by contract size and scope

Bonus Incentives

Earn commission on personal training packages and renewals. If you bring an existing client base, you can hit the ground running and start earning from day one. Coaches who drive growth and retain clients have strong upside potential.

D1 Training is a rapidly growing fitness franchise with over 80 facilities open and more than 180 in development. At D1 Training, we are committed to inspiring and motivating athletes to achieve their goals through science-backed, results-driven training. We focus on training the entire body as a unit to maximize performance—no gimmicks, no fads, just proven techniques used to develop the world’s top athletes. Every workout follows a structured 8-week training cycle, meticulously designed and backed by sports science to deliver real, measurable progress. What started as a program for aspiring youth athletes has evolved into comprehensive training for adults and teams, helping individuals at every level push toward their full potential.

D1 Training Alliance is a premier, veteran-owned athletic training facility located in Alliance Town Center in Fort Worth, TX. Owned and operated by a former athlete and U.S. Marine Corps veteran, our facility offers elite-level strength, speed, and agility training for youth athletes, adults, and teams.
